Mr. Speaker. the death of a friend Is always a great personal loss. but the death of a friend who was a great patriot is much more. The passing last Tuesday of the Honorable Thaddeus M. Machrowicz was a tragedy shared not only by those of us who knew him well. but by every American. The son of a Polish immigrant. he rose from a justice of the peace in Hamtramck. Mich.. to Federal district judge in Detroit. In between. he served six distinguished terms in this body representing the former First Congressional District on Detroits East Side. Judge Machrowiczs career was built on a deep and dedicated love for his country.
